    Crucial Steps in Assessing a Patient’s Stoma and Surrounding Skin

    A comprehensive assessment of the stoma and periwound skin involves several key steps. Visual inspection is paramount, looking for signs of skin irritation, breakdown, or infection. Assessing the stoma’s size, shape, and color provides valuable information. Proper measurement is crucial for selecting the appropriate ostomy appliance. The condition of the surrounding skin, including erythema, excoriation, or maceration, needs careful evaluation.

    Palpating the skin for tenderness or edema provides further insight. The presence of any discharge or odor should be noted. Furthermore, assessing the patient’s ability to manage the appliance and perform skin care procedures is essential.

    Steps in Teaching Self-Care and Maintenance, Enterostomal therapy et nurse

    A structured approach to teaching self-care is essential. Initially, demonstrate the procedure and provide clear, step-by-step instructions. Subsequently, encourage the patient to practice the technique under supervision. Reinforce the learning by providing written materials, and ensure the patient feels comfortable asking questions and expressing concerns. Regular follow-up appointments are crucial for addressing any difficulties and reinforcing knowledge.

    Maintaining Clean and Dry Peristomal Skin

    Maintaining a clean and dry peristomal skin is paramount for preventing complications. Frequent cleaning with mild soap and water is vital to remove any residue. Thorough drying of the skin is equally important to prevent moisture buildup. Applying a thin layer of skin barrier is crucial to creating a protective layer against irritation.

    Techniques for Applying Skin Barriers and Ostomy Pouches

    Proper application of skin barriers and ostomy pouches is essential for optimal function and skin protection. A key step involves ensuring the skin is clean and dry before applying the barrier. Applying the barrier evenly and securely helps prevent leaks and ensures a proper fit. Ensuring the barrier extends slightly beyond the stoma’s edges aids in containing leakage and preventing skin irritation.

    Unique Needs of Specific Patient Populations

    Different patient groups present with varying needs and challenges in enterostomal therapy. These factors can significantly impact the patient experience and treatment outcomes. Recognizing these nuances is critical for effective care.

    • Pediatric Patients: Children require specialized equipment and procedures tailored to their developmental stage and size. Proper sizing and application techniques are paramount to ensure comfort and prevent skin breakdown. Additionally, the emotional and psychological aspects of stoma care must be considered in children, involving the family in the process is crucial for support and education.
    • Geriatric Patients: Elderly patients often have co-morbidities, impacting their overall health and treatment tolerance. Considerations include reduced mobility, cognitive function, and potential medication interactions. Frequent monitoring and adjustments to the therapy plan are necessary to maintain their well-being.
    • Patients with Disabilities: Patients with physical disabilities may require adaptations in equipment and care routines. This might include specialized stoma appliances, assistive devices, or caregiver training. Ensuring accessibility and comfort is critical in these cases.
    • Patients with Mental Health Conditions: Mental health conditions can significantly affect a patient’s ability to cope with enterostomal therapy. Support groups, counseling, and patient education programs are vital to help patients adapt to their new lifestyle. Open communication and empathy are essential in building trust and fostering adherence.
    • Patients with Co-morbidities: Patients with other medical conditions (e.g., diabetes, chronic kidney disease, or immune deficiencies) require a comprehensive assessment to identify potential complications and adjust the enterostomal therapy plan accordingly. Collaboration with other healthcare professionals is vital to ensure holistic care.

    Challenges Faced by Patients with Specific Conditions

    Certain medical conditions can exacerbate the challenges of enterostomal therapy. Understanding these challenges allows for proactive interventions and support.

    • Diabetes: Patients with diabetes often experience increased risk of skin breakdown and delayed wound healing. Strict adherence to skin care routines, frequent monitoring, and prompt management of any complications are crucial.
    • Obesity: Obese patients may experience challenges with fitting appliances and maintaining skin integrity. Specialized appliances and meticulous skin care are often necessary to minimize skin irritation.
    • Chronic Kidney Disease (CKD): Patients with CKD may have reduced wound healing capacity. Appropriate intervention and close monitoring are essential to prevent complications and ensure optimal recovery.

    Pharmacokinetic Interactions

    Pharmacokinetic interactions occur when one medication alters the absorption, distribution, metabolism, or excretion of another. These changes can significantly impact the blood levels of the interacting drugs, leading to either insufficient or excessive drug concentrations. For example, a medication that inhibits the liver enzymes responsible for metabolizing another drug can cause a buildup of the latter, potentially leading to toxic effects.

    This can result in unwanted side effects or reduced therapeutic efficacy.

    Pharmacodynamic Interactions, Dont combine these copd medicines

    Pharmacodynamic interactions occur when two or more medications act on the same target or receptor, leading to additive, synergistic, or antagonistic effects. For example, combining a bronchodilator with a medication that also has bronchodilatory properties may result in excessive bronchodilation, potentially causing unwanted side effects such as tachycardia or tremors. Similarly, combining medications with opposing effects can diminish the overall efficacy of the treatment.
